Human leukocyte elastase (HLE) participates in tissue
destruction in a number of inflammatory disorders, including rheumatoid
arthritis and cystic fibrosis. Since HLE has been shown to bind to
Mac-1, and ICAM-1 plays a key role during the recruitment and the
activation of leukocytes at inflamed sites, we investigated the
capacity of HLE to cleave ICAM-1. Flow-cytometric analyses showed a
dose-dependent cleavage of ICAM-1 by HLE on different human cell lines.
The cleavage was completely inhibited by
1-antitrypsin, a natural
HLE protease inhibitor. The ability of HLE to degrade ICAM-1 was
further confirmed by electrophoretic analysis using a soluble form of
ICAM-1 (D1-D5). Enzymatic removal of N-linked
glycosylation did not significantly modulate ICAM-1 cleavage by HLE,
while removal of sialic acid residues partially reduced the sensitivity
of ICAM-1 to HLE. We further showed that sputum of cystic fibrosis
patients contains high levels of HLE activity capable of cleavage of
cell surface ICAM-1. The cleavage induced by incubation of cells with
the sputum sample was totally inhibited by
1-antitrypsin and the
specific peptidic HLE inhibitor
N-methoxysuccinyl-Ala-Ala-Pro-Val-chloromethylketone.
Moreover, the cleavage of ICAM-1 was concomitant to that of CD4 at the
surface of the same cell, at the same amplitude, and at all HLE
concentrations. The capacity of HLE to modulate the expression of
ICAM-1 on the surface of leukocytes by proteolytic cleavage brings
support to the hypothesis that overproduction of HLE can cause severe
immunologic lung disorders by affecting intercellular
adhesion.
